This Saturday, June 29th from 2-5 we will be having an “I’m a Girl Scout!” LGBTQ+ Pride Month patch activity session. Girl Scouts of all levels are invited to come to celebrate diversity, learn about the history of Pride and the importance of loving and accepting ourselves and others for who we are. Scouts and their adults will be able to visit several different stations at their own pace and do the activities together. Girl Scouts will earn the LGBTQ+ Pride Month segment of the “I’m a Girl Scout!” Multicultural Community Celebrations Fun Patch series. This is a free event and you are welcome to come by anytime between 2 and 5 but we recommend giving yourselves at least half an hour to explore the different stations.
